Marriages Act, 1972

Amendment of section 36 of Matrimonial Causes and Marriage Law (Ireland) Amendment Act, 1870.

13.Section 36 of the Matrimonial Causes and Marriage Law (Ireland) Amendment Act, 1870, is hereby amended by the insertion of “or one only of them is a Protestant Episcopalian,” before “any bishop” and by the insertion of “and, in case of the absence from illness or other reasonable cause of a bishop or a vacancy in a see, the grant of such licences may be effected by the person authorised by the laws of the said Church to exercise the functions of bishop” after “episcopal superintendence”.
